Every participant is eligible to receive tutoring. The participant and a member of the staff will discuss what type of tutoring is best in order for him/her to master assigned coursework. Learning Enhancement Center tutor/mentors will provide academic support assistance in numerous disciplines.
Counseling
The assistant director and academic advisor/counselor will interview and assess each eligible applicant. Together, they will identify the student’s academic and self development needs. Additionally, students will have access to career, personal and academic related counseling services.
Seminars
Seminars offered by the program include, but are not limited to, the following: financial assistance, test-taking skills, career planning, time management, note-taking skills, GRE, GMAT, LSAT, and MCAT test preparation seminars and graduate and professional school information. Each seminar is carefully designed with the student’s best interest in mind.
Financial Aid Advisement
The program provides assistance in completing the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) and facilitates seminars/workshops on how to apply for and receive financial aid.
Computer / Copier/Internet Access
Moreover, participants are afforded access to educational support resources such as a xerox copier, computers, laptops, printers, and the internet.
Cultural Enrichment
Participants are offered an opportunity to attend activities that foster cultural enrichment such as award winning Broadway plays and University theatrical productions.
